2012 Lexus LF-A Officially Priced at $375,000

2011 Porsche Cayenne Official Details and Images Revealed
Porsche has released official details and images of the new 2011 Porsche Cayenne. The new Cayenne will go on sale first in Europe starting May 8th of this year and then hit the U.S. market in July. A 3.6-liter V6 with 296hp will be used in the entry level Cayenne. The Cayenne S will sport a 4.8-liter V8 with 395hp and the “go-fast” turbo edition will use the same V8 with the addition of a twin-set of turbos to make 500hp.
By the Numbers: Audi RS5 vs. BMW M3
I know that it can be rather premature to compare the E92 BMW M3 to the new Audi RS5 considering that no one has driven the new RS5. Can we be a little hypothetical here just for a minute? Okay, great. Let’s take the new E92 BMW M3 with all of its 414hp and 295 ft-lbs. of torque V8 glory and put it up against the new 2011 Audi RS5’s naturally aspirated 450hp and 317 ft-lbs. of torque 4.2-liter V8. What do you get? Obviously you get a much more powerful engine in the RS5. But that’s where I draw the line for the advantages of the RS5 over the current BMW M3.
